网上鲜花销售系统概要设计
3星 · 超过75%的资源 需积分: 10 92 浏览量
更新于2024-09-15
1
收藏 152KB DOC 举报
"鲜花销售需求分析"
这篇文档是关于一个名为《网上鲜花销售系统》的概要设计说明书,主要用于分析和设计一个网上花卉销售平台的需求。这个系统旨在服务花卉的生产企业、市场、代理商、分销商以及普通消费者,提供商品浏览、购买、支付、订货和订单查询等功能。
1. **编写目的**
系统的设计目的是为了构建一个前台系统(面向顾客)和后台系统(供管理员使用),实现花卉产品的在线销售和服务。前台系统提供用户友好的界面,支持各种交易活动;后台系统则用于管理网站内容和处理后台操作。
2. **项目背景**
在完成软件可行性研究和需求分析后,系统分析员需要进行概要设计,这包括模块结构划分、功能分配、数据结构设计等。此项目由一家鲜花销售公司发起,由该公司的一位副总经理协助开发,使用SQL Server 2005作为数据库。
3. **任务概述**
系统的主要目标是实现用户注册、登录、购物、支付等一系列功能。同时,后台管理系统应能进行商品管理、订单处理、库存控制和客户服务。
4. **总体设计**
设计涵盖了处理流程、系统总体结构和模块外部设计。功能分配确保了所有功能被合理地分配到各个模块中。
5. **接口设计**
外部接口涉及用户与系统的交互,内部接口则关注系统各组件之间的通信。
6. **数据结构设计**
数据结构设计包括逻辑结构和物理结构,以及它们与程序的关系,确保数据的有效存储和访问。
7. **运行设计**
运行设计明确了运行模块的组合、控制方式以及运行时间安排。
8. **出错处理设计**
出错处理设计旨在提供清晰的错误信息输出,并制定相应的错误处理策略,以保证系统稳定性和用户体验。
9. **安全保密设计**
安全保密设计是确保用户信息和个人隐私的安全,防止未经授权的访问和数据泄露。
10. **维护设计**
维护设计考虑了系统未来可能的更新和升级需求,以适应业务变化和技术发展。
参考资料包括多本关于SQL Server、数据库系统和ASP.NET开发的专业书籍,表明设计过程参考了权威资料,确保了设计的专业性和实用性。
这个网上鲜花销售系统是一个全面的电子商务平台,旨在整合线上线下资源,提升花卉销售的效率和便利性。通过细致的需求分析和设计,系统能够满足不同用户群体的需求,同时保证操作的稳定性和安全性。
2020-07-29 上传
2023-06-10 上传
2023-06-06 上传
2023-05-30 上传
2023-03-30 上传
2023-07-17 上传
2023-06-06 上传
huishen8926
- 粉丝: 24
- 资源: 3
最新资源
- RPSL:机器人感知规范语言(RPSL)
- 学生成绩管理系统(java实现).zip
- java11_64_bin.zip jdk11免费下载
- My-FreeCodeCamp-Code:我来自训练营的代码
- eulerian_video_magnification:实现欧拉视频放大并用于心率检测等
- pet-projects.dev-frontend:用于https:dev-pet-projects.github.io的Nuxt.js Buefy前端
- cpp代码-162.4.4.2
- matlab由频域变时域的代码-speaker-recognition:说话人识别
- 【课设警告】每个Java老师都喜欢的学生成绩管理系统.zip
- Amzl_Proto
- JSG202227 2022年江苏省职业院校技能大赛(高职) 电子产品芯片级检测维修与数据恢复 赛项规程.zip
- 9cc:小型C编译器
- yamame1212.github.io
- GAN_model:使用GAN生成3D网格模型
- 差异:用于生成字符串差异的简单gem
- Xshell7个人免费版